The Climate Bonds Initiative conducted a scoping exercise to identify the potential for US municipal issuers to scale up green bond issuance. The study identified USD 264 billion in outstanding bonds from 1,436 'pure-play' climate-aligned issuers—entities deriving more than 95% of their revenue from climate solutions—most of which are not currently labeled as green bonds.

  • US municipal green bond issuance grew from the first issuance in 2013 by the Commonwealth of Massachusetts to USD 12 billion in 2017, representing 27% of total US green bond issuance for that year.
  • Green bond issuance among US municipals declined in the first half of 2018, mirroring a broader trend where total US municipal issuance fell 22% between January-May 2017 (USD 162 billion) and January-May 2018 (USD 127 billion). This was largely driven by a 58% drop in refunding bond issuance following the Tax Cuts and Jobs Acts of 2017.
  • A scoping exercise identified 1,436 'pure-play' climate-aligned issuers with USD 264 billion in outstanding bonds. Only USD 14 billion of this total has been issued as green bonds by 23 of these issuers.
  • The water sector is the largest climate-aligned theme, accounting for 64% (USD 170 billion) of the identified bond universe and featuring 1,141 pure-play issuers. The New York City Municipal Water Finance Authority is the largest non-green bond issuer in this sector with USD 26 billion outstanding.
  • The transport sector represents 30% (USD 78.5 billion) of the identified climate-aligned bonds across 52 issuers. The Massachusetts Bay Transportation Authority is the largest non-green bond issuer in this sector with USD 5.8 billion outstanding.
  • The waste, land use, and energy sectors are identified as underrepresented in the green bond market. The waste sector has 65 issuers (USD 8 billion outstanding), land use has 171 issuers (USD 4.8 billion outstanding), and energy has 7 identified pure-play issuers (USD 2.6 billion outstanding).
  • The report identifies significant potential for green bond scaling through the refinancing of maturing bonds. Examples include the Los Angeles Department of Water and Power (USD 420 million maturing within a year), the Atlanta Department of Watershed Management (USD 1 billion maturing in two years), and the Massachusetts Bay Transportation Authority (USD 460 million maturing by June 2020).
